Welcome to the Farequill pricing experiment! The `/v2/quotes` endpoint returns ticket prices with an experiment bucket attached, so don't be surprised if two calls disagree — that's the point. Buckets are assigned per session by the Shufflet service. To pull experiment assignments in dev, call Shufflet directly using the internal key on the following line.

gateway credential: kto23_LX9A4ys6i4nzHtpOLNLodKK

# Approvals: Websocket Reconnect Fix

Support team: the fix for the Brightmoor client reconnect storm has cleared staging and awaits final production approval. Until it ships, affected customers should be advised to restart the desktop app once, not repeatedly. Escalations during the approval window go through the standard queue. The approver of record is named below.

account owner for fajep-yagef: Kasix Eliiel

# Approvals: Validator Plugin System

Support team reference for the Marrowfield validator plugin system. Third-party validator plugins must pass the sandbox conformance suite before being enabled for any customer. Support may not toggle unapproved plugins, even temporarily, as a workaround. Escalations about rejected plugins should include the conformance report and the customer's schema sample. Final approval or rejection of any validator plugin rests with the person named below.

account owner for bawip-tahag: Raleth Quenok